The upcoming SpaceX Crew-10 mission launch will carry to the International Space Station a technology developed in Puerto Rico that could transform water purification both in space and on Earth.
El Fideicomiso para Ciencia, Tecnología e Investigación de Puerto Rico is announcing the launch of an innovative project developed on the Island that will travel to the International Space Station.
The Rhodium Water Filtration 01 project, led by Dr. David Suleiman Rosado of the Universidad de Puerto Rico en Mayagüez, aims to transform the way water is purified in space.
The experiment will lift off with the NASA SpaceX Crew-10 mission this Wednesday, March 12, at 7:48 p.m. (Puerto Rico time). The live broadcast of the launch will be available on the NASA website.
The project introduces a new technology for cleaning water in space more efficiently. Currently, purifying water on the International Space Station is costly and energy-intensive. The system developed by Dr. Suleiman makes it possible to treat water using fewer resources, an important advance for both space missions and applications on Earth.

A collaboration advancing Puerto Rican science
The project has received initial funding from NASA and has the support of the Programa de Subvenciones para Investigación of El Fideicomiso para Ciencia, Tecnología e Investigación de Puerto Rico. Also participating is Rhodium Scientific, a company that specializes in bringing experiments to the International Space Station.

Puerto Rico on the space map
This achievement marks a significant step forward for Puerto Rican science, making this the second project from the Island to reach the International Space Station through this collaboration.
